How Much Does a Market Risk Management Make in California?

Updated April 01, 2025
As of April 01, 2025, the average annual pay of Market Risk Management in California is $141,557. While Salary.com is seeing that Market Risk Management salary in CA can go up to $172,650 or down to $110,187, but most earn between $125,137 and $157,832.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, and your experience levels. Top 10 Highest Paying Cities For Market Risk Management Jobs in California

It is important to understand how location impacts your career prospects in the United States. There are some cities where a Market Risk Management can find a job easily with a greater salary paid then achieve a higher standard of living. Below is the top cities list for Market Risk Management job salaries in California. Some cities can pay higher salaries for Market Risk Management jobs, which can indicate that there is a large demand for Market Risk Management positions in this city.
The following table shows top 10 cities where the Market Risk Management salary is higher than other cities in California. San Jose takes first place in this list, followed by Santa Clara, Fremont. The Market Risk Management salary is $161,873 in San Jose, which is higher than the national average. There are 76 cities' Market Risk Management salary higher than national average in California.
The average salary for a Market Risk Management in California is $141,557, but we found that the city with the highest salary for Market Risk Management jobs is San Jose, CA, and it is higher than Santa Clara. Market Risk Management jobs in San Jose can have the opportunity to earn higher salaries than in other cities in California.
CITY ANNUAL SALARY MONTHLY PAY WEEKLY PAY HOURLY WAGE
San Jose $161,873 $13,489 $3,113 $78
Santa Clara $161,873 $13,489 $3,113 $78
Fremont $161,565 $13,464 $3,107 $78
San Francisco $160,282 $13,357 $3,082 $77
Daly City $160,282 $13,357 $3,082 $77
Berkeley $156,727 $13,061 $3,014 $75
Oakland $156,727 $13,061 $3,014 $75
Hayward $156,470 $13,039 $3,009 $75
Antioch $147,871 $12,323 $2,844 $71
Vallejo $144,381 $12,032 $2,777 $69
